We’re Addicted to Comfort (And It’s Holding Us Back)

Episode 42 with Jill Griffin & Molly Bierman

In this episode of No Permission Necessary, Jill and Molly explore how the pursuit of comfort and convenience can unintentionally limit growth and resilience.

They discuss the role of discomfort in personal development, the impact of overprotecting ourselves and others, and the importance of building routines that support both structure and flexibility.

The conversation highlights how small, consistent actions, especially around sleep, movement, and daily habits, can create a foundation for navigating more challenging aspects of life.
